 I suppose I should have reworded/extended my reasons. I can see this
 is something that is not going to be dropped.

 Paldo still uses 2.3.x as the stable version of Fontconfig. Not that
 this is a big thing, but it does indicate that Jurg has not fully
 tested, or is comfortable, with 2.4.x. I know I am not. It took
 Keith a year and a half to come up with the 2.4.x version and
 within a week of release, it was determined that there were major
 flaws. I'm just not comfortable updating, and the chief reason is
 that nothing is gained other than it is 'easier' to configure.

 Backporting fixes and all that is *not* going to happen. We either
 go with the current version, or go with the updated version. It is
 my opinion that the new version can't be tested as well as it should
 at this point in time.

 Additionally, it sounds as if you (Dan) are the only person at this
 time qualified to support the update. Alexander doesn't count as he
 has mentioned his availability to the LFS project is soon to be nil
 (if it isn't already).

 Again, this situation needs to be discussed on -dev and a determination
 should be made after:

 1) what really the benefits are other than it is easier to configure
 2) who really knows it and is comfortable in helping to support it
 3) who all is going to do the testing
 4) how will the testing be accomplished

 Dan, I appreciate your quest for a 'better' font system. But I just
 don't see the existing one as broken. And with that, to me a major
 change to something that affects much of BLFS should be left for time
 to do months of testing in a development environment.
